Player Spotlight: RB Frank Goodin, ULM Warhawks

By Daniel Freer | June 13, 2008

6 Player Spotlight:  RB Frank Goodin, ULM Warhawks The Scene: Bryant-Denny Stadium, November 17th, 2007. A back-up tailback scores the game-tying third-quarter touchdown in one of the biggest upsets of the season, as Louisiana-Monroe stunned Alabama 21-14 in front of announced crowd of over 92,000…the vast majority Crimson Tide fans.

That back-up tailback, Frank Goodin (right, Icon SMI) , is now the starting tailback for the Warhawks for the 2008 season.

It would be wise for all fantasy players to get familiar with the quick and diminutive RB (5-9, 196), for he will be one of the key break-out players this season.

Goodin, a redshirt-sophomore, played high-school football at Louisiana powerhouse West Monroe High School. Signing and redshirting with the Warhawks in 2006, Goodin saw a lot of playing time in 2007 even though ULM already had a star in its backfield, Calvin Dawson.

Although Dawson got the majority of the work last season, Goodin’s stats as a backup were impressive: 596 yards rushing, 5.1 yards per carry, and 4 rushing TDs, adding 117 yards and 1 TD receiving. Plus, Goodin produced two 100+ yard rushing games, including a 102 yard effort at Clemson in only the second college game of his career.

Another plus for Goodin in 2008 will be the lack of depth at the RB position for the Warhawks, which means there will not be as much ball-sharing in the ULM backfield this season. Goodin not only will not have Calvin Dawson ahead of him on the depth chart….he will not have a lot behind him, either. Expect a lot of carries and receptions out of the backfield for Goodin.

The Warhawks offense returns starting QB Kinsmon Lancaster and NFL prospect Zeek Zacharie at TE. Although the offensive line will have two or three new starters in 2008, the line will return three-year starters Aaron Schutz and Larry Shappley . ULM head coach Charlie Weatherbie has done a good job keeping up the level of talent and depth at the school, so the losses of starters on the line will not be much of an effect on Goodin’s production.

Another plus for Goodin is that ULM’s schedule will not be as difficult in 2008 as compared to 2007. After the opener at Auburn, the Warhawks will face out-of-conference games at Arkansas, home vs. Alabama A&M, and at Tulane, with a November 15 game at Ole Miss…and the games between Arkansas and Ole Miss are actually competitive ones for the Warhawks, with both of those programs on the way down in the SEC. Within the Sun Belt Conference, ULM gets both conference front-runners Troy and Florida Atlantic in Monroe.

Starting position, good supporting cast on offense, and a not-too-difficult schedule: All good reasons to expect Frank Goodin to be one of the fantasy break-out players in 2008.
